Glioblastoma multiforme (GBM) is a highly aggressive brain cancer characterized by high rates of invasion and disease progression. While the importance of GBM cell-astrocyte gap junctions (GJ) in GBM invasion has been established, molecular mechanisms underlying GJ-mediated GBM invasion have yet to be determined. In their study on page 319, McCutcheon and Spray queried if Connexin 43 (Cx43), an astrocyte GJ protein expressed in nearly every GBM tumor, participates in GBM invasion. As pictured on the cover, the authors injected cytosolic mCherry-expressing GBM cells into ex vivo brain organotypic slice cultures and used immunofluorescence and confocal microscopy to assess GBM cell invasion. The cover depicts a GBM cell cluster with reduced invasion capacity in a brain slice in which astrocytes lack Cx43, where GBM cells are red, Cx43 is green, and cell nuclei are blue. Dichotomously, the authors found that Cx43 reduction in GBM cells increases GBM cell invasion. Altogether, the data elucidate novel molecular innerworkings of GBM cell invasion that could inform targeted GBM therapeutic strategies.
